自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(49)
  • 收藏
  • 关注

转载 hadoop namenode的恢复

hadoop如何恢复namenode博客分类: hadoop Namenode恢复 1.修改conf/core-site.xml,增加 Xml代码  property>          name>fs.checkpoint.periodname>             value>3600value>

2013-01-17 10:35:39 494

转载 java读写Excel(POI)

POI官方网址:http://poi.apache.org/POI的功能实在很强大,而且是apache的子项目,它下面又包含一些Component,比如处理Excel XLS,PowerPoint PPT,Word DOC,Outlook MSG,Excel XLSX等,下面就简单讲下poi处理excel的一些内容。下面的jar包来源于当前最新的poi 3.6版本。1.poi来生成ex

2012-10-22 14:51:45 463

转载 tomcat https访问设置

前几天客户提出要强制使用HTTPS方式访问Tomcat中的相关项目,于是研究了下,现将具体的步骤写下:     主要分2步:让tomcat能使用https--->强制使用https访问 1.让tomcat能使用https   A.在运行命令JAVA_HOME/bin/keytool -genkey -alias tomcat -keyalg      RSA  -key

2012-08-28 15:43:18 454

转载 Spring加载静态资源的方式

Spring3中js/css/jpg/gif等静态资源无法找到(No mapping found for HTTP request with URI)问题解决最近项目中使用到Spring3,在感叹Spring3注解配置清爽的同时竟然出现了这个不和谐的事情,实在无法忍受问题:部署项目后程序加载或用浏览器访问时出现类似的警告,2011-01-19 10:52:51,646 WARN [

2012-07-13 13:43:12 5258

原创 hbase问题记录

1 org.apache.hadoop.hbase.client.ScannerTimeoutException 一般在大表的scan时会超时,默认是60000,可以在conf阶段设置。conf.setLong(HConstants.HBASE_REGIONSERVER_LEASE_PERIOD_KEY, 120000)  2

2012-06-18 15:56:26 626

原创 HBase数据备份和恢复

1, hbase自带的备份恢复工具 bin/hbase org.apache.hadoop.hbase.mapreduce.Driver export \table_name /local/pathbin/hbase org.apache.hadoop.hbase.mapreduce.Driver import \table_name /local/path导入时必须先创建表结构。

2012-06-14 11:47:36 2877 1

原创 Greenplum备忘

一、Greenplum数据库的启动与停止1-常规则的greenplum数据库启动与停止:启动:gpstart停止:gpstop重启服务:gpstop –r强制停止服务:gpstop -f -c2-postgresql.conf 与 pg_hba.conf配置文件变后,需要重新装载修改后的参数,而且不停止数据服务:Gpstop –u(注

2012-05-21 11:13:05 515

转载 Tomcat6.x 不显示详细日志的问题

以前用Tomcat用得好好的,项目启动的时候错误日志都会输出到控制台,不知道从啥时候开始,Tomcat的详细错误日志不见了,只报一个万恶的Context [] startup failed due to previous errors,却找不到previous errors具体是啥东西,郁闷了很久,在网上查了一下资料,终于解决了这个问题。     Tomcat的官方原文在http:

2012-05-14 14:02:46 8064

转载 MySql删除重复记录

新建一个临时表 create   table   tmp   as   select   *   from   youtable   group   by   name 删除原来的表 drop   table   youtable 重命名表 alter   table   tmp   rename   youtableMYSQL 时间的比较以 TimeStamp为例

2012-04-17 09:24:38 361

原创 linux客户端显示中文

有时候我们会在linux系统中存放一些中文文件,为了能在客户正常显示,需要做一些设置;1 查看系统支持的语言集    #locale -a 如果发现结果没有中文语言包 可以用 yum install fonts-chinese 下载中文语言包2查看当前的语言#echo $LANG3改变当前的语言包 vi /etc/sysconfig/i18n 改成LANG=”z

2012-03-23 16:13:09 583

原创 myeclipse jvm设置

在myeclipse中运行main函数时,回报jvm内存溢出的错误,可以用下面的方法调整(这个和eclipse.ini中的设置不一样),在installed jre 选择edit 然后添加-Xms64m -Xmx1024m//测试代码public static void main(String[] args) {System.out.println(" 内存信息 :" +

2012-03-21 11:01:04 1111

原创 linux下用gridsql做postgresql集群

1 环境准备   3台linux(CentOS5.5)服务器(分别为node1,node2,node3)。   gridsql-2.0-0.noarch.rpm2 postgrel 准备    2.1 每台服务器都需要安装postgresql 本文以postgresql0.9 为例。     注意:安装完postgresql后 务必要把postgresql_home/bin 加

2012-03-02 16:39:56 931

原创 linux下的postgrel9.0安装

1 下载 postgres-9.0.6-1.x86_64.openscg.rpm  2 安装  用root用户 执行 rpm -ivh postgres-9.0.6-1.x86_64.openscg.rpm 3 启动  /etc/init.d/postgres-9.0-openscg start 4 问题:    1、 默认安装,客户端不能访问 会出现:pg_hba.con

2012-03-02 12:09:39 709

原创 hive导入和导出数据

hive官方提供两种导入数据的方式  1 从表中导入: insert overwrite table test select * from test2; 2 从文件导入:   2.1 从本地文件导入:      load data local inpath '/hadoop/aa.txt' overwrite into table test11

2012-02-29 16:05:45 961

转载 hadoop集群升级失败回滚策略

一.错误概述 因为需要使用hadoop与hbase结合使用,所以需要为hadoop hdfs升级使用append写模式。需要对现有的hadoop 0.20.1 升级至0.20.205.0; 升级过程简单的使用 hadoop namenode -upgrade 从 -18 version => -32version(这个是dfs/name/current/VERSION).但我们发现

2012-02-29 11:02:39 1254

原创 postgresql 默认模式顺序和改变

postgresql有模式(schema)的概念,其实就是在数据库中划分范围,也就是在不同的模式中,可以有同名的表。可以简单理解为文件系统。  常用的默认模式是public。SHOW search_path;显示现有的模式搜寻顺序,具体的顺序,也可以通过SET search_path TO 'schema_name'来修改顺序。这样的修改只能在当前连接中有效,如果需要长久生效可以为

2012-02-27 17:25:37 4973

原创 linux 下MySQL快速安装和client访问授权

yum install mysql-server //安装mysql服务端/etc/init.d/mysqld start  //启动mysql服务器---------------------------------client 访问授权----------------------------------------------------MYSQL中有一张user表 保存了数据库

2012-02-27 17:21:04 676

原创 用sqoop导入数据到hive中

1 安装sqoop     下载sqoop-1.2.0.tar.gz(1.20版兼容hadoop0.20版本)   将 hadoop-core-0.20.2-cdh3u3.jar ,hadoop-tools-0.20.2-cdh3u3.jar 放入sqoop/lib目录下,这两个jar包是cloudera公司出的 ,可以去它的官网下载。2 从mysql中导入数据   进入s

2012-02-27 14:52:02 5007

原创 hive linux环境下的安装

1. 下载hive-0.8.0.tar.gz,hive运行需要依赖hadoop集群,保证hadoop集群的正常运行。2. 将hive-0.8.0.tar.gz解压(一般我们都将hive安装在hadoop的namenode节点上)。    需要在环境变量中添加HADOOP_HOME,HIVE_HOME这两个环境变量即可。   如果不再特殊操作,这样就可以了,3 启动#hive

2012-02-24 16:15:11 3599

原创 MemCached分布式安装

1 Memcache服务端是C写成的,首先准备安装包memcached-1.4.13.tar.gz2 MemCached安装需要依赖GCC和li'bevent,所以首先要安装这2款软件, GCC一般linux都会自带,用gcc -v 查看是否安装了。 查看libevent是否安装 用   ls -al /usr/lib |grep libevent  或者  ls -al /usr/l

2012-02-20 17:19:24 444

原创 Hbase分布式安装

1 Hbase集群需要依赖Hadoop集群和zookeeper集群 ,首先需要确保上述两项安装成功。(hbase对hadoop的版本有要求,具体匹配信息可以参考hbase官方文档,本文使用hadoop0.20.2 + hbase0.90.5)2  下载 hbase0.90.5.tar.gz 解压    tar -xvf  hbase0.90.5.tar.gz     ln -s hba

2012-02-17 10:20:23 2829

原创 zookeeper分布式安装

1 环境准备:3台linux  CentOS5.5服务器 ,下载zookeeper-3.4.2.tar.gz并将只上传至服务器。2 开始安装:    2.1  tar  -xvf  zookeeper-3.4.2.tar.gz     2.2  ln -s zookeeper-3.4.2.tar.gz  zookeeper //做别名,方便访问。    2.3 vim zookee

2012-02-16 13:56:38 662

转载 JConsole使用

JConsole使用一、JConsole远程监控Tomcat服务器   为了解决内存溢出的问题,会用到一些监视内存的工具,jconsole这个工具是jdk5.0自带的工具,所以如果你的jdk是5.0那么就不用去安装。 这个工具可以查看系统的 堆,非堆,线程,等等的一些整体的情况,从而可以判断出系统的一个大概的性能情况。 那么配置如下:如果你是用tomcat,在catalin

2012-02-15 15:03:53 298

原创 在运行jar包的过程中处理引用第三方jar包方法

1 在windows环境中添加jar包到classpath set classpath=.;E:\ncrdb.jar;E:\terajdbc4.jar;  (以分号分割)添加属性文件 java -jar attrcheck.jar ./attCheck.properties 2 在linux环境中java -classpath xx.jar:xxx.jar

2012-02-14 11:29:57 533

原创 hadoop分布式 安装(3台节点)

1 环境准备:3台CentOS5.5操作系统的主机,jdk为OpenJDK1.6.0 ,Hadoop版本为0.20.2。2 修改hosts文件,把整个聚群的主机名和IP对应起来,每台机器都需要做。(我用主机名来做hadoop标志,为后续zookeeper做准备,zookeeper只能用主机名,比较搓)  vi /etc/hosts   192.168.110.223  Paas1

2012-02-13 13:49:36 558

原创 ActiveMQ 安装(linux)

ActiveMQ在linux下安装非常简单,步骤如下:1 环境准备:    系统环境CentOS5.5 、 JDK版本为OpenJDK1.6.0 设置JAVA_HOME。    下载 apache-activemq-5.5.1-bin.tar.gz 。 2 安装步骤   上传apache-activemq-5.5.1-bin.tar.gz到服务器,解压   tar -xvf

2012-02-13 10:05:52 1818

原创 数据库中的隔离级别和锁机制(包含MySql的测试)

ANSI/ISO SQL92标准定义了一些数据库操作的隔离级别:1        未提交读(read uncommitted)2        提交读(read committed)3        重复读(repeatable read)4        序列化(serializable)锁机制:   共享锁:其他事务可以读,但不能修改。   排他锁:其他事务不能读取

2012-02-08 18:27:27 775

原创 MemCached安装

1 在安装MemCached之前需要有GCC和LibEvent服务 可以用gcc -v 查看是否已安装GCC。2 安装libevent 首先下载libevent包 上传到服务器 #tar -zxvf libevent-1.4.13-stable.tar.gz //先解压缩 #cd libevent-1.4.13-stable //切换到libevent的目录中 #./conf...

2012-02-07 17:02:59 70

原创 zookeeper安装

下面我以ubuntu 9.10环境为例进行部署Zookeeper1.1安装前准备1.Java6 环境要求安装如果用Zookeeper在windows条件下运行,应该安装Cygwin.2.在hhtp://hadoop.apache.org/zookeeper/releases.html下载稳定释放zookeeper并在合适的地方解压% tar xzf zookeeper-x.y....

2012-01-16 15:27:24 90

原创 hbase安装配置

1、hbase安装部署#cd /hadoop#wget http://apache.etoak.com//hbase/hbase-0.20.6/hbase-0.20.6.tar.gz#tar -zxvf hbase-0.20.6.tar.gz #ln -s hbase-0.20.6 hbase#mkdir hbase-config#cd /hadoop/hbase/conf...

2012-01-12 11:29:51 173

原创 hadoop 安装部署

2台机器:master(192.168.110.223),slave1(192.168.110.222)系统都为Centos 5 假设将master做为namenonde,将slave1做为datanode 1.在master:(在slave1上操作和以下相同) vi /etc/hosts 192.168.110.223 master 192.168.110.222 ...

2012-01-10 09:37:28 170

原创 java中的基本类型和长度

基本类型:byte 二进制位数:8包装类:java.lang.Byte最小值:Byte.MIN_VALUE=-128最大值:Byte.MAX_VALUE=127基本类型:short 二进制位数:16包装类:java.lang.Short最小值:Short.MIN_VALUE=-32768最大值:Short.MAX_VALUE=32767基本类型:int 二进制位数:...

2011-12-14 14:58:40 169

原创 spring3.0 事物

spring3.0中提供了多种事物管理方式,我喜欢aop的实现方式1:AOP方式实现事物,以单数据源为例 --定义advice --定义切点 ---注意 在java中获取连接要用 DataSourceUtils.getConnection(dataSource2)同时datasource2和...

2011-12-07 17:16:45 72

原创 spirng3.0 IOC

spring 3.0 提供了灵活多变的bean声明方式 个人任务基于xml和annotation方式联合使用是一种比较合理的方式,下面是使用过程中的需要注意的点1:每一个DispatchServlet都有自己的作用域,他是继承自公共域,所以公共域中的所有定义在dispatchServlet中是可以直接使用的。(注意:用注释定义的资源全部属于子类,也就是DispatchServlet的作用域,在...

2011-12-06 17:17:27 70

原创 spring常用配置记录

//数据源配置1 或者加上xmlns:jee="http://www.springframework.org/schema/jee"http://www.springframework.org/sc...

2011-12-02 14:52:20 85

原创 java中常用的一些协议记录

1 corba实现中的iiop(internet-inter ORB protocol)协议 ,corba是基于IIOP协议实现远程通信,实现机理是corba客户端和服务端分别生成ORB代理,客户端ORB封装数据,传递到服务端ORB接受和解释数据。在传递数据的过程中还是使用TCP或者UDP传输?我觉得是TCP,这个问题遗留下来。2 rmi使用jrmp(java remote messagin...

2011-10-25 10:41:56 186

原创 浏览器清理缓存设置

1.browser 设置每次访问都清空页面缓存在IE下我们可以直接去修改internet选项/常规/浏览历史记录/到internet临时文件选项的设置中,将检查网页中的较新版 本改成每次访问此页时检查在firefox的地址栏上输入about:config回车 找到browser.cache.check_doc_frequency选项,双击将3改成1保存即可。...

2011-10-11 17:01:25 156

原创 webservice记录

1 查看jboss服务器上的所有webservice服务http://localhost:8080/jbossws/services2 用CXF框架实现webservice现在的项目中需要用到SOA概念的地方越来越多,最近我接手的一个项目中就提出了这样的业务要求,需要在.net开发的客户端系统中访问java开发的web系统,这样的业务需求自然需要通过WebService进行信息数据...

2011-10-10 16:22:05 91

scea,summarise

a architecture should have 7 features.perfermance:to measure a system's perfermance,you can use how many seconds a page form respose or how many transactions can be dealed in one seconds.reliabli...

2011-08-30 11:23:32 92

原创 struts-奇怪问题集

1,在struts-config文件中 controller 标签之后 更 message-resource 顺序还不能错2,struts加载的时候 可能会报Parsing error processing resource path 错误,这有可能是struts-config.xml中的头引起的,原因是config文件中声明的标签和实际的dtd文件对应不上,建议最好是有1.1的 就不会有这种...

2011-04-06 15:45:34 62

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除